Staff Sgt. James Weishaupt, 362nd Training Squadron A-10 crew chief apprentice course instructor, climbs up the side of an A-10 Thunderbolt II at Sheppard Air Force Base, Texas, Oct. 10, 2018. Originally becoming an instructor was a assignment, but recently the Air Force has changed that to a volunteer duty, offering those Airmen who actively want to teach the opportunity to choose when in their career to come and train the next generation of Airmen.
